Professional Door Technicians: The Unsung Heroes of Building Maintenance
In the bustling world of building and construction and maintenance, professional door technicians play a vital function in guaranteeing that structures remain functional, secure, and accessible. These knowledgeable experts are typically the unsung heroes who keep doors, locks, and access systems running efficiently. This short article explores the world of professional door technicians, exploring their responsibilities, the abilities they need, and the importance of their work.
The Role of a Professional Door Technician
Professional door technicians are concentrated on the setup, maintenance, and repair of numerous types of doors, locks, and access control systems. Their role is diverse and extends beyond simply fixing broken doors. Here are some of the crucial obligations of a professional door technician:

Installation and Setup
- Setting up brand-new doors, locks, and hardware in property, industrial, and commercial settings.
- Establishing access control systems, including electronic locks and keycard readers.
- Guaranteeing that all setups satisfy security and security requirements.
Maintenance and Repair
- Routinely checking and maintaining doors and locks to prevent problems.
- Fixing broken or malfunctioning doors, hinges, and locks.
- Troubleshooting and fixing problems with access control systems.
Security Assessments
- Carrying out security assessments to identify vulnerabilities in a structure's gain access to points.
- Suggesting and executing security upgrades, such as installing high-security locks or enhancing door frames.
Customer support
- Supplying excellent customer care by communicating efficiently with clients.
- Providing guidance and guidance on door and lock maintenance.
- Ensuring that customers are satisfied with the service supplied.
Compliance and Safety
- Making sure that all work abides by regional building regulations and policies.
- Abiding by safety protocols to avoid accidents and injuries.
Skills and Qualifications
To excel as a professional door specialist, one must possess a mix of technical skills, physical abilities, and interpersonal qualities. Here are a few of the important abilities and credentials:
- Technical Expertise: A deep understanding of door and lock systems, along with experience with different kinds of gain access to control systems.
- Problem-Solving Skills: The ability to identify and deal with complicated issues efficiently.
- Physical Stamina: The job often involves lifting heavy doors, working in tight areas, and standing for extended periods.
- Attention to Detail: Precision is vital when setting up or repairing locks and hardware.
- Client Service Skills: Effective interaction and the ability to work well with clients.
- Accreditations: Many door technicians hold accreditations from professional organizations, such as the Door and Hardware Institute (DHI).
The Importance of Professional Door Technicians
The work of professional door technicians is important for numerous factors:
Safety and Security
- Properly maintained doors and locks are important for the security and security of buildings and their residents.
- Professional technicians ensure that gain access to control systems are functioning properly, avoiding unapproved entry.
Accessibility
- Doors that open and close smoothly are crucial for accessibility, particularly in public buildings and those with high foot traffic.
- Technicians guarantee that doors fulfill ADA (Americans with Disabilities Act) standards, making them accessible to all users.
Energy Efficiency
- Correctly set up and kept doors help to decrease energy usage by avoiding air leaks.
- This can lead to lower energy bills and a more sustainable structure environment.
Expense Savings
- Routine maintenance and timely repairs can extend the lifespan of doors and locks, reducing the requirement for expensive replacements.
- Professional technicians can identify prospective problems before they end up being significant problems, conserving clients cash in the long run.
FAQs About Professional Door Technicians
Q: What is the average wage for a professional door specialist?A: The wage for a professional door technician can vary depending on aspects such as place, experience, and expertise. Typically, door technicians can make in between ₤ 30,000 and ₤ 60,000 annually, with more experienced experts earning higher salaries.
Q: What are the most common kinds of doors and locks that door technicians deal with?A: Door technicians deal with a wide range of doors and locks, consisting of:
- Residential doors and locks (e.g., deadbolts, lever handles)
- Commercial doors and locks (e.g., exit devices, panic bars)
- Industrial doors and locks (e.g., high-security locks, electronic gain access to control systems)
- Specialized doors (e.g., fire-rated doors, automatic moving doors)
Q: How can I end up being a professional door specialist?A: To become a professional door specialist, you can follow these steps:
- Complete a high school diploma or equivalent.
- Enroll in a trade school or employment program that uses courses in door and lock installation and repair.
- Gain hands-on experience through an apprenticeship or entry-level position.
- Consider getting certifications from professional organizations like the Door and Hardware Institute (DHI).
Q: What tools do professional door technicians utilize?A: Professional door technicians use a variety of tools, including:
- Screwdrivers, wrenches, and pliers
- Lock picks and stress wrenches
- Power tools (e.g., drills, saws)
- Measuring tools (e.g., tape procedures, calipers)
- Diagnostic devices for electronic access control systems
